Islands with the same name

A small curiosity about the name of two of the island of the Tuscan Archipelago. The islands that constitute the Archipelago are Elba, Giglio (21,2 kmq) - Capraia (19,3) - Montecristo (10,4) - Pianosa (10,25) - Giannutri (2,6) - Gorgona (2,23). The northern one is Gorgona which is in front of Livorno, while the southern one is Giannutri, which is a little bit further south from Mount Argentario, in front of Montalto di Castro in the region of Lazio. In front of the costs of Puglia, north of the Peninsula of Gargano, there is instead the Archipelago of Tremiti. Two of the islands of of this latter Archipelago are called as two of the islands in the Tuscan Archipelago: Pianosa and Capraia. The regions of Tuscany and Puglia have hence two islands with the same name. Even if the islands of Pianosa and Capraia in Puglia are much smaller that the Tuscan 'sisters': not even a square metre between the two of them (Pianosa measures only 700 metres x 250 metres).
